President Ruto Commends Dawoodi Bohra Community, Reaffirms Kenya’s Education And Infrastructure Agenda

President William Ruto has lauded the Dawoodi Bohra community for its significant contributions to Kenya’s growth, particularly in housing, healthcare, and education.

He highlighted the impact of Aljamea-tus-Saifiyah, a world-class Arabic academy, in promoting learning, values, and social development.

Speaking during a visit to the Aljamea-tus-Saifiyah Nairobi campus in Karen, Nairobi County, President Ruto emphasized the importance of strengthening and sustaining partnerships with communities that support national development.

Present at the visit were His Holiness Syedna Mufaddal Saifuddin, Shahzada Qaidjoher Ezzuddin, rector of Aljamea-tus-Saifiyah, Prime Cabinet Secretary Musalia Mudavadi, and other senior leaders.

President Ruto reiterated that education remains central to Kenya’s transformation agenda. He underscored the government’s commitment to equipping 60 per cent of learners with skills in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ics, creating a workforce capable of driving innovation and economic growth.

He further linked this vision to Kenya’s ambitious infrastructure development plan, which includes generating 10,000 megawatts of energy, developing 30,000 kilometers of roads, constructing a modern airport, and modernizing the health sector.

The visit highlighted Kenya’s commitment to collaboration with the Dawoodi Bohra community, fostering partnerships that support education, innovation, and sustainable socio-economic development.
